Appalachian State University (APP) Golf Financial Data

NCAA Membership Financial Reporting System (MFRS) · Sun Belt · Data available: FY2021–FY2025

In fiscal year 2025, Appalachian State University (APP)'s Golf program reported $434K in revenue and $935K in expenses, for a net deficit of $501K. The largest revenue source was Contributions at $301K. Among the 76 FBS programs reporting Golf data, Appalachian State University ranks 65th overall in total expenses (23rd of 34 Group of Five programs) — below the FBS average of $2.0M. Appalachian State University competes in the Sun Belt; financial data is available from FY2021 through FY2025.

Appalachian State University Golf — Financial Context

The golf program operated at a $501K deficit in FY2025, with $434K in revenue — heavily reliant on contributions at $301K — falling well short of $935K in expenses. At $935K, the program ranks 65th among 76 FBS schools in golf spending, sitting well below the FBS average of $2.0M. Expenses have nonetheless grown steadily over the past five years, nearly doubling from $512K in FY2021 to $935K in FY2025, with Sports Equipment, Uniforms and Supplies representing the largest single cost at $293K.
